WHAT DO I NEED TO WEAR & BRING? Please bring a water bottle and sweat towel, and wear clean trainers. Pilates socks or bare feet are welcome for the finishing flow. We also recommend having a light meal or snack beforehand—exercising on an empty stomach can cause blood sugar levels to drop quickly, leaving you feeling faint. All other equipment is provided in the studio, and we have a bathroom available for your convenience.

I'M PREGNANT CAN I STILL ATTEND SESSIONS? You sure can. I have worked with Midwives in the past during clients pregnancy and postnatal if returning soon after birth. This is to keep you supported and safe as the body changes. It is important to remain active during pregnancy. However if during the Strength HIIT you decide the pregnancy is making it too difficult, I will offer a credit to your account to access in the future for the remaining classes.
WHEN CAN I GET BACK INTO SESSIONS POST BABY? I ask that you wait until at least 6 weeks after you have given birth. If you want to come back earlier, I request clearance from your medical practitioner. If you birthed via C-section a 12 week wait is required. I trained to work alongside Physiotherapists and Obstetricians if there are any post-natal issues.

WHAT'S INVOLVED IN Strength & FLOW All you need to bring is a willingness to give it a go—we welcome all ages and fitness levels! You'll train in a small group of up to 4 people, working through a variety of exercises with fresh routines each week. A strength-focused class using weights and bodyweight exercises on the mat/floor, finishing with a flexibility flow to lengthen and restore the body on the mat/reformer. There's no competition—just you, moving at your own pace, with our support and motivation to help you become the best version of yourself.
